Output e23e8e1da205ed503196a2273b384c6bae7b6943d33c7ef43a6b1f0ae453c5a5:4

value
2064208
script pubkey
OP_0 OP_PUSHBYTES_20 623175381299d850550e24711b154fb4af65d42e
address
ltc1qvgch2wqjn8v9q4gwy3c3k920kjhkt4pwyqn6lm
transaction
e23e8e1da205ed503196a2273b384c6bae7b6943d33c7ef43a6b1f0ae453c5a5
spent
true